sr. technical manager
- Managed mission critical outsourced computer applications for the Comptroller of Currency (OCC), US Treasury, regulator of all national banks, thrifts, and savings associations in the United States of America
- Played a key role in establishing workload, capacity, and change management process for newly awarded $180 million multi-year application management contract involving a staff of 100+ contractors
- Provided daily oversight for performing operations and maintenance activities along with budget responsibility for a portfolio of applications totaling $20 million dollars per year, nearly 1/3 of the total annual budget assigned to the outsourcing vendor
- Led a team of 25 contractor & client staff, supporting agency’s mission critical business applications supporting key functional areas
- Led IBM Rational experts to provide enterprise wide change management capability to the OCC
- Led a team of security experts to implement identity and access management solution based on CA security products

How to include technical skills in your resume:
Technical skills are a set of specialized abilities and knowledge required to perform a particular job effectively. Some examples of technical skills are data analysis, project management, software proficiency, and programming languages, to name a few.

How to include soft skills in your resume:
Soft skills are non-technical skills that relate to how you work and that can be used in any job. Including soft skills such as time management, creative thinking, teamwork, and conflict resolution demonstrate your problem-solving abilities and show that you navigate challenges and changes in the workplace efficiently.
